Event:WMA Technical Introduction to CapX
Wiki Mentor Africa (WMA), in collaboration with the Capacity Exchange (CapX) team, invites you to a technical introduction session exploring the technology behind Capacity Exchange.
The Capacity Exchange (CapX) is a Wikimedia platform that enables Wikimedians to find and connect with one another to exchange knowledge, skills, mentorship, and services across the movement.
While CapX provides a platform for community collaboration, this session will focus on the technical side of the project. Exploring the tools, technologies, workflows, and processes that power CapX.
The session aims to introduce members of the WMA community and the wider Wikimedia technical community to CapX as an open source project, with the goal of encouraging new contributors to participate in its continued development and improvement.
